在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 14593|回复: 17

[求助] 求教,analogLib库里的vprbs器件的参数如何设置?

[复制链接]
发表于 2018-5-29 14:50:41 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
请问一下:有谁了解Cadence analogLib库中的vprbs源的seed以及Feedback Shift Register如何设置?看了userguide,对seed的介绍不是很详细,因此不是很清楚在产生PRBS信号时seed的作用;至于第二个参数Feedback Shift Register,手册则完全没有提到,只有一个叫tap的参数,不晓得是不是一回事?有什么作用?请用过这个东西的大神指导一下,最好有个示例什么的,谢谢了!
 楼主| 发表于 2018-6-30 13:34:36 | 显示全部楼层
本帖最后由 物理10086 于 2018-6-30 13:37 编辑

自己补充一下吧!对于analogLib库中的vprbs源,seed大概指的是随机数种子,Feedback Shift Register指的是利用Linear feedback shift register方法产生PRBS序列的反馈系数,如下图的4-bit LFSR电路。 2.jpg
 楼主| 发表于 2018-6-30 13:41:56 | 显示全部楼层
seed的作用还没搞清楚,似乎是初始值,但是仿真看不出区别。而Feedback Shift Register的设定则可以决定产生的序列是PRBS几,这一定已经通过仿真验证了。PRBS序列与TAP之间的关系如下表: 3.jpg

这个结论是参考了
《Use Readily Available Components to Generate Pseudo-Random Binary Sequences and White Noise》


这篇文章的,链接如下:https://www.digikey.com.cn/zh/ar ... quences-white-noise
发表于 2019-2-2 16:10:54 | 显示全部楼层
只需在Feedback Shift Register里面设置反馈点即可,比如RPBS7=X7+X6+1,设置7,6。
发表于 2020-12-17 10:07:50 | 显示全部楼层


物理10086 发表于 2018-6-30 13:41
seed的作用还没搞清楚,似乎是初始值,但是仿真看不出区别。而Feedback Shift Register的设定则可以决定产 ...


请问这个taps是什么意思,在参数设置里并没有这个选项啊
发表于 2020-12-17 11:35:35 | 显示全部楼层
请问楼主Vprbs您明白了吗
 楼主| 发表于 2021-1-14 23:25:38 | 显示全部楼层


LDC0226 发表于 2020-12-17 10:07
请问这个taps是什么意思,在参数设置里并没有这个选项啊


就是LFSR的抽头,比如PRBS7里的7和6抽头,异或之后作为反馈。vprbs设置里是有这个选项的,明天我再补一下截图,目前没有。
 楼主| 发表于 2021-1-14 23:26:35 | 显示全部楼层


LDC0226 发表于 2020-12-17 11:35
请问楼主Vprbs您明白了吗


seed还是没搞明白,而且新版的vprbs增加了很多新的选项,就更为复杂了。
发表于 2021-1-15 10:39:30 | 显示全部楼层


物理10086 发表于 2021-1-14 23:26
seed还是没搞明白,而且新版的vprbs增加了很多新的选项,就更为复杂了。


我之前试了好几种seed,但是他的输出没有变化,这是我最不能理解的地方了
发表于 2021-8-12 09:55:04 | 显示全部楼层
学习啦
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/1 下一条

小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-18 19:54 , Processed in 0.028422 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表